The National Liberal Party has backed calls for a National Dialogue underscoring the need to address genuine governance concerns raised by the youth.
Party Leader Augustin Muli has however cautioned that the talks could be hijacked by the political class with the party proposing that the talks be led by a non-politically aligned organization.
The Party has hailed the recent formation of the Framework for Compensation of Victims of Demonstrations and Public Protests by President William Ruto.
This even as the party announced that it would field a Presidential candidate in the 2027 General elections in what it says is meant to upset the status quo.
